How to increase team autonomy?

"A lot of the people who are more introvert might have a better view of what actually happened in there than those who are being extroverted." - Ben Linders

In this episode, I talk to Ben Linders about what really drives team autonomy and effective software development. We get into team culture, the importance of psychological safety, and why diversity matters - not just as a feel-good topic, but as a genuine catalyst for change. Ben shares practical tips from his workshops, discussing how teams can move from being stuck to taking meaningful action. We discuss, how to avoid that sticky notes from retrospectives gather dust and how to make results visible, keeping actions manageable, and introducing a little bit of fun through gamification.

Ben Linders runs a one-person business in Agile, Lean, Quality, and Continuous Improvement. Ben is a well-known speaker and author; he is much respected for sharing his experiences and helping others share theirs. His books and games have been translated into more than 12 languages and are used by professionals in teams and organizations all around the world. As a trainer, facilitator, coach, and advisor, he helps organizations with effectively deploying software development and management practices. He focuses on continuous improvement, collaboration and communication, and professional development, to deliver business value to customers.

Highlights:

  • Psychological safety is essential for effective team collaboration and problem solving.
  • Diverse perspectives enrich problem understanding and lead to better solutions.
  • Avoid blame and finger pointing to protect trust within the team.
  • Visualization and clear, actionable steps turn ideas into real improvements.
  • Gamification and fun foster openness and experimentation during workshops.
